Early Life and Background

Born in 1994, Jean Arnault grew up in an environment steeped in luxury and culture. The son of one of the wealthiest individuals globally, Jean was exposed to the intricacies of the fashion and luxury industries from an early age. He attended prestigious institutions, including the École Polytechnique in France, where he studied engineering, and the London School of Economics, where he focused on management.

Jean’s upbringing provided him with a unique perspective on the world of luxury. He witnessed firsthand the intricate balance between creativity and commerce, understanding that the essence of luxury lies not just in the product itself but in the storytelling and experience surrounding it. His education and family background shaped his ambition to innovate within the industry, leveraging the legacy of his family’s brand while infusing fresh ideas.

Professional Journey

Jean Arnault’s professional journey began in earnest when he joined the family business, LVMH, in 2017. His entry into the luxury sector was marked by a determination to bring a modern touch to traditional practices. Initially, he took on roles across various brands under the LVMH umbrella, gaining valuable insights into the workings of the industry.

One of Jean’s notable contributions was his involvement with Louis Vuitton, one of the crown jewels of the LVMH portfolio. He quickly became a key player in the brand’s strategy, focusing on expanding its digital presence and enhancing customer engagement. Understanding the significance of technology in modern retail, Jean championed initiatives to integrate digital experiences with the brand’s storied heritage.
